The Hohem iSteady Pro 4 is a versatile 3-axis gimbal stabilizer designed for action cameras, including the latest GoPro models. With a maximum weight capacity of 150g, it features an IPX4 splash-proof design, ensuring durability in various conditions. The gimbal boasts a 14-hour battery life and can even charge your camera while recording. Its quick release clip and Bluetooth control make it user-friendly, perfect for both casual vloggers and extreme sports enthusiasts.

The product was used for stabilizing various GoPro cameras. Please not that it will NOT fit the GoPro 11 Mini. It is simply too thick for that particular camera. Others, no problem. It does an excellent job of stabilization, and when used with the electronic stabilization of the GoPro 11, your videos will become quite smooth, there there is still just a bit of movement detected while walking. It also works in a pinch, as an acceptable tripod. It's good for a day of shooting, and will probably outlast your patience during the day. I really enjoyed using it, and the price is right. Neither is it too heavy. I've a larger stabilizer, for heavier cameras (Canon, Sony, etc.), but when I want to go light, and compact, the GoPro/Hohem iSteady Pro 4 is only a light burden, on a day trek.

I did my research and narrowed my choice down to this unit despite some of the not so good reviews. I especially liked the review in which the individual compared this to a vibrater. Item arrived on time and anxious to try it out with my GoPro. Much to my surprise, the previously mentioned review was accurate. When power up, it just vibrated with camera attached. Even after turning down the axis torque settings it would still hum a bit, plus now the axis motors didn’t have enough power to move the camera around. I sent it back for a replacement and that one also did the same thing. Mechanical design team did a really nice job with this as it seems to be well made and sturdy. The electrical engineering of this unit is a lot to be desired. Sorry HOHEM, but you need to go back to the drawing board on this one.

Initially the gimbal looks good out of the packaging. As advertised the gimbal will charge your devices. Two different charging ports. One for the camera and a usb port to charge other devices.Installing the action cam on the gimbal can be a little tricky. Do not try to install the camera on the gimbal with any kind added cases or cages. The arm that locks the camera in place will jam and possibly break. Do not turn the gimbal on without a camera installed. It will act a straight fool and make you think something is wrong with it.Gimbal movements work for the most part but sometimes the gimbal tends to do its own thing and turn upside down or completely shift to the wrong direction. When this happens you have to turn the gimbal off and manually turn it back around correctly. This only really happens when you're trying to get a shot at Ann awkward angle.The weight of the gimbal loaded with a camera isn't bad. Fairly comfortable to use and carry for an extended amount of time. However the framing and mechanics of the gimbal gets in the way of your view finder which makes looking into the screen to get a good shot challenging at times. Because of that reason I don't really use the gimbal that much compared to an extendable selfie stick. The gimbal can be added to a selfie stick or tripod but make sure your tripod has a wide base. The higher you go the worse the balance and center of gravity gets.I'd like the product at a slightly cheaper cost though. Ultimately you don't really need a gimbal with higher quality action cams like GoPro or DJI due to the built in stabilization. However if you're looking for a cinematic shot or slowing down the footage in post, the gimbal is worth it.In closing I will keep the gimbal and put it to use when I absolutely need it.
